  4. GERMAN AIR RAIDS ON LONDON CONTINUE UNCEASINGLY

    It was officially announced that to 10 p.m. yesterday 47 raiders had been shot down over Britain. Further figures show that German losses in Saturday's raids were 103 machines. Yesterday's first warning in the London area sounded at 5.10 p.m.; the all clear was given 75 minutes later. The second warning sounded at ...
